WWE Taping Shows, Even Wrestlemania?
New reports are emerging that some or all of Wrestlemania may be taped ahead of time. According to reports from POST Wrestling (h/t CagesideSeats) WWE is implementing an “aggressive taping schedule” and is aiming to tape all Raw and SmackDown episodes between now and Wrestlemania this week. One of the sources believes that both Wrestlemania shows will be taped as well, but one other source was unsure. WrestleVotes chimed in as well:
The rumor regarding WWE taping shows everyday for a week straight starting tomorrow is very much true. Goes to show you, much like AEW, they are unsure how long they’ll be able to do this. WWE is trying to get as much in as possible it seems.
— WrestleVotes (@WrestleVotes) March 20, 2020
With the rapidly evolving circumstance around COVID-19, WWE seems to want to get as much content recorded as possible. Vince McMahon appears set on the show going on, so he may want to get to it as soon as he can.

AEW Dark Tapings – Spoilers
At Wednesday’s AEW Dynamite tapings, the company recorded matches for AEW Dark both before and after the main show. This was likely in an attempt to get as many episodes of Dark, or even content for Dynamite, done ahead of time.
